I'm so sorry for your loss, it's always heartbreaking when something like this happens This is a topic that is a little controversial, and many people have strong opinions. I know it used to be commonplace to keep rabbits and guinea pigs together because spaying and neutering were not as safe as they are today. Keeping rabbits and guinea pigs gave them a chance for socialization without risk of multiplying, and they typically fight less with members of other species. The main concerns that people have now with keeping the two species together are that rabbits can potentially injure guinea pigs and some illnesses that rabbits get can pass to guinea pigs and cause a much more severe reaction. What I would do in this situation is keep the rabbit and guinea pig in separate enclosures, but still allow them to have a lot of playtime together. This is, of course, assuming that your new rabbit is well behaved and gentle around Ginger and both are healthy.

Rabbits and dogs together can be tough. This is something that generally depends on the personality of the animals, so it's good that you're being careful about this. My advice would be to either give your rabbits a room where the dog isn't allowed, or to fence off parts of the home to separate the rabbit territory from the dog territory. Then you can give them supervised and controlled playdates to see if they can ever be compatible enough to live together.
